mardi 21 avril 2015

Firefox not showing span over a div

am making a text box with a prefix of currency. i use the following css

.currencyInput {
     position: relative;
 .currencyInput input {
     padding-left: 25px;
 .currencyInput:before {
     position: absolute;
     top: 0;
     left: 5px;
        border:1px solid #31BAF9;
        width:-webkit-calc(95% - 11px);
        width:calc(95% - 11px);
        padding:0 5px;
        margin:5px auto;
<span class="currencyInput">
        <input type="text" class="text-box1" placeholder="Price" value="35750.00"name="price"/>

this code works good in chrome. but when it comes to Firefox the span data is not shown. any idea?!

